Notes |
- Thomas and William Lamberth both farm labourers of Chestnut England were tried at Herts Q.S. 1.10.1833 for “ stealing fowls” . They were transported to Van Diemen’s land for 7 year arriving at Hobart 11.08.1843 arriving on vessel “John Barry”.
Thomas married Jane Mills who was also convicted at Glamorganshire Assize 25.02.1841 for “stealing from the Person “. She arrived at Hobart 10.10.1841 onboard “Garland Grove”.
Thomas and jane and children John, William Henry and Emma departed Launceston on October 16th 1851 on board the Shamrock to Port Phillip and then travelled to the Bendigo goldfields settling in White hills. Thomas rented and worked a 20-acre farm at Sandy creek. His death unfortunate. He dies in March 1876 at the age of 59 as a result of injuries falling down a mine shaft. Jane dies March 19th, 1882 aged 68 and both buried at White hills.
